Exploring the Fascinating Career of Gordie “Mr. Hockey” Howe
When it comes to hockey legends, few can compare to the great Gordie “Mr. Hockey” Howe. Born in Floral, Saskatchewan, in 1928, Howe’s career spanned over five decades, making him one of the most iconic players in the history of the sport.
Howe began his career with the Detroit Red Wings in 1946, where he quickly established himself as one of the game’s best players. With his combination of skill, strength, and toughness, he earned a reputation as an unstoppable force on the ice.
Over the course of his 25-year career, Howe amassed an incredible list of achievements. He won the Art Ross Trophy six times as the NHL’s top scorer and the Hart Memorial Trophy as the league’s MVP six times as well.
But Howe’s impact on the sport extended beyond his individual achievements. He was a team player who was always willing to do whatever it took to help his team win. And his tough, physical style of play set a standard for future generations of players to follow.
Howe’s Journey to Becoming a Hockey Legend
Early Life: Gordie Howe was born in Saskatchewan, Canada, in 1928, and grew up playing hockey with his siblings on a frozen pond behind their home. Despite being small for his age, he quickly developed into a skilled player, and his talent did not go unnoticed.
The Detroit Red Wings Years: Howe began his professional career in 1946 with the Detroit Red Wings, where he quickly established himself as a top player in the league. Over the next few years, he led the team to several Stanley Cup victories and won numerous individual awards.
The WHA Years: After a brief retirement in the 1970s, Howe returned to professional hockey to play in the upstart World Hockey Association (WHA), where he continued to dominate the ice, despite being in his 40s. He played several seasons for the Houston Aeros, leading them to two championships.
Retirement and Legacy: Howe retired from professional hockey in 1980, leaving behind a legacy as one of the greatest players in the history of the sport. He inspired generations of hockey players and fans, and his impact on the game continues to be felt to this day.
